A New Era of Low-Carbon Shipping
Ocean carriers have begun deploying vessels powered by methanol, LNG, biofuels, and early-stage ammonia-ready propulsion systems. Several major shipping lines have already launched dual-fuel fleets designed to reduce COβ emissions by up to 40% on select routes.
Industry analysts say 2025 marks a defining year as green-powered vessels move from pilot projects to mainstream operations across major trade lanes, including the Transpacific, AsiaβEurope, and Latin America routes.
Regulatory Pressure Accelerates Adoption
The IMOβs tightened emissions rules and the rollout of its Carbon Intensity Indicator (CII) scoring system are pushing carriers to modernize operations. Shipping companies failing to meet emissions grades now face increased fuel costs, required retrofits, and potential restrictions on vessel deployment.
To stay compliant, fleets are investing heavily in:
Hull optimization and drag-reducing coatings
Smart routing software using weather and current data
Electric and hybrid port equipment
Shore-power systems to eliminate emissions while berthed

Green Corridors Gain Momentum
Several major βgreen shipping corridorsβ β routes with standardized low-carbon vessels, fuel availability, and port technology β are now being developed. The most notable include:
AsiaβU.S. West Coast green corridor
SingaporeβRotterdam clean-fuel lane
JapanβAustralia methanol pilot route
Latin AmericaβEurope sustainable reefer corridors
These corridors aim to establish consistent standards, improve global fuel accessibility, and provide measurable carbon reductions on high-volume trade lanes.
Investment Surges Into Alternative Fuels
The push for sustainability is also reshaping the fuel market. Global energy companies are investing billions into producing:
Green methanol
Hydrogen and ammonia
Advanced biofuels
Synthetic e-fuels
While true zero-emission ocean shipping remains years away, experts say the groundwork being laid today will determine the future of maritime energy consumption.
